Hello, guys. 3 months ago, I posted a fan-made map by me , but then I realised that it was not perfect or accurate.

Old one:

https://i.imgur.com/cwrzRNo.jpg

Therefore, I modyfied some parts to present it better.

Two main changes:

  1. Ionia should be smaller.(changed)

  2. Southern Continent should be bigger, as a continent full of anciente civilizations, such as Targon, Shurima, Icathia.

Take a look.

Entire Map: https://i.imgur.com/0QzBxY3.jpg

Southern Continent (modifed):

https://i.imgur.com/jRKchM1.jpg

BTW, if you want an original map with 37M, I can send you in email.

And, I add " Unknown Lands extending toward the south" for more mysterious spaces

Icathia is actually beside the sea,according to the new lore.

In addition, I modified the south freljord
